AI:

SPARQL(SPARQL Protocol and RDF Query Language)是一种用于查询RDF数据的查询语言,它是语义Web技术中的重要组成部分之一。SPARQL的主要作用是在RDF数据中进行查询和过滤,帮助用户快速地找到所需的数据。

SPARQL的语法比较灵活,可以使用不同的模式进行查询。SPARQL查询语言主要由三个部分组成:SELECT、WHERE和ANSWER。SELECT部分定义了要返回的结果集,WHERE部分定义了查询的条件和约束,ANSWER部分定义了查询的答案。

SPARQL的查询可以使用多种约束和条件,例如FILTER、OPTIONAL、UNION、BIND等。FILTER用于过滤结果集,OPTIONAL用于指定可选的模式和匹配,UNION用于组合多个查询,BIND用于定义临时变量和计算。

SPARQL的应用非常广泛,它可以用于查询各种类型的RDF数据,例如人物、地点、事件、组织等。在语义Web的应用中,SPARQL可以用于构建智能搜索引擎、推荐系统、自动化推理等各种应用。另外,SPARQL还可以与其他语义Web技术和工具进行集成,例如OWL、RDFa、RDFS等。

然而,SPARQL的发展还面临一些挑战。例如,SPARQL的查询效率和性能需要不断优化和提高,以满足大规模数据处理的需求。另外,SPARQL的标准和规范也需要不断更新和完善,以适应不断变化的需求和环境。

总之,SPARQL是一种用于查询RDF数据的查询语言,它可以用于查询各种类型的RDF数据。SPARQL的应用非常广泛,它可以用于构建智能搜索引擎、推荐系统、自动化推理等各种应用。然而,SPARQL的发展还面临一些挑战,需要不断优化和提高

human URL的作用; AI AI URLUniform Resource Locator统一资源定位符是URI的一种特定形式它是一种用于定位互联网上资源的标准格式。URL由协议名、主机名、路径、查询字符串和片段标识符等部分组成它可以用来标识Web页面、图像、视频、音频等各种类型的资源。URL的主要作用是定位互联网上的资源使用户能够直接访问和使用这些资源。在Web开发中URL通常用于标识网

原文地址: https://www.cveoy.top/t/topic/ftrA 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录